Output 9013958e7abb616dbbfd12810c284d984ad7e480db6ced88e8ac78857ed56292:0

value
3898469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be7a7ff134def41448290a94c6ef9b3a2a38abe OP_EQUAL
address
34EZgUq4sZCwRdXYdDhior4rhWxiWPPpBo
transaction
9013958e7abb616dbbfd12810c284d984ad7e480db6ced88e8ac78857ed56292
confirmations
195545
spent
true